Dino Geek, versucht dir zu helfen

Wie verwende ich die Anmeldung bei MongoDB?


Die Anmeldung bei MongoDB erfolgt meistens durch eine Kombination aus Benutzername und Passwort, die in den Connection-String Ihrer Anwendung eingefügt wird.

Hier sind die allgemeinen Schritte, um sich bei MongoDB zu authentifizieren:

1. MongoDB Server konfigurieren: Sie müssen sicherstellen, dass Ihr MongoDB-Server so konfiguriert ist, dass er Anmeldeinformationen erfordert. Sie können dies tun, indem Sie den `—auth` Parameter beim Starten Ihres MongoDB-Servers hinzufügen.

2. Benutzer erstellen: Der nächste Schritt besteht darin, einen Benutzer in der MongoDB-Datenbank zu erstellen, auf die Sie zugreifen möchten. Sie können dies mit dem Befehl `db.createUser()` in der MongoDB-Schaltfläche erreichen. Damit können Sie einen Benutzer mit einem Benutzernamen und Passwort erstellen und Rollen zuweisen, die die Aktionen bestimmen, die der Benutzer auf der Datenbank ausführen kann.

3. Verbindung herstellen: Schließlich verwenden Sie den Benutzernamen und das Passwort, um eine Verbindung zu Ihrer MongoDB-Datenbank herzustellen. Wie dies genau funktioniert, hängt von der Bibliothek oder dem Werkzeug ab, das Sie verwenden, um eine Verbindung zu MongoDB herzustellen. In den meisten Fällen fügen Sie die Anmeldeinformationen jedoch in den Connection-String ein, den Sie verwenden, um eine Verbindung zu MongoDB herzustellen. Dies sieht normalerweise so aus: `mongodb://username:password@localhost:27017/`.

Stellen Sie sicher, dass Sie Ihre Anmeldeinformationen sicher aufbewahren und nie im Klartext in Ihrem Code speichern. Es wäre eine gute Praxis, Umgebungsvariablen zu verwenden, um Ihre sensiblen Daten wie Anmeldeinformationen zu speichern.


Erstellen Sie einfach Artikel, um Ihr SEO zu optimieren
Erstellen Sie einfach Artikel, um Ihr SEO zu optimieren





DinoGeek bietet einfache Artikel über komplexe Technologien

Möchten Sie in diesem Artikel zitiert werden? Es ist ganz einfach, kontaktieren Sie uns unter dino@eiki.fr

CSS | NodeJS | DNS | DMARC | MAPI | NNTP | htaccess | PHP | HTTPS | Drupal | WEB3 | LLM | Wordpress | TLD | Domain | IMAP | TCP | NFT | MariaDB | FTP | Zigbee | NMAP | SNMP | SEO | E-Mail | LXC | HTTP | MangoDB | SFTP | RAG | SSH | HTML | ChatGPT API | OSPF | JavaScript | Docker | OpenVZ | ChatGPT | VPS | ZIMBRA | SPF | UDP | Joomla | IPV6 | BGP | Django | Reactjs | DKIM | VMWare | RSYNC | Python | TFTP | Webdav | FAAS | Apache | IPV4 | LDAP | POP3 | SMTP

| Whispers of love (API) | Déclaration d'Amour |






Rechtliche Hinweise / Allgemeine Nutzungsbedingungen